First Balad-Bound C-5

First Balad-Bound C-5 A crew based at Dover AFB, Delaware, flew the first C-5 Galaxy into Balad, Iraq, on 12 November, increasing the Air Force presence at the Army's logistical support area. A fourteen-person crew and approximately twenty-one truckloads of war materiel were on board the aircraft. Because the routes used to convoy cargo on the roads to Balad are dangerous, having fewer Army trucks on the road translates to more American lives saved.
